What is the FARO Freestyle 3D X Laser Scanner?
The FARO Freestyle 3D X is a portable laser scanner that captures objects and spaces in three dimensions. It uses laser technology to measure distances and create detailed 3D models. This scanner is lightweight and easy to use, making it perfect for both professionals and beginners. Imagine being able to scan a statue, a room, or even an entire building and have it all in 3D on your computer!

Key Features of the FARO Freestyle 3D X
The FARO Freestyle 3D X comes with several impressive features that make it stand out:
1. High Precision
One of the most remarkable aspects of the Freestyle 3D X is its accuracy. It can measure distances with an accuracy of up to ±2 mm (0.08 inches). This means it can capture even the smallest details, which is crucial for projects where precision is key.
2. Lightweight and Portable
Weighing only about 1.3 kg (2.9 lbs), the Freestyle 3D X is lightweight and easy to carry. This makes it perfect for on-the-go scanning. Whether you’re in a studio or outdoors, you can take it anywhere!
3. Fast Scanning Speed
The scanner can capture up to 480,000 points per second. This means it can gather a lot of data very quickly, making the scanning process much faster than traditional methods. For example, it can scan an entire room in just a few minutes!
4. User-Friendly Interface
The device features an intuitive touchscreen interface, making it easy to operate. Even people who are not very tech-savvy can learn to use it quickly. The interface guides users through the scanning process, ensuring they get the best results.
5. Real-Time Visualization
One of the coolest features of the Freestyle 3D X is its ability to show real-time visualizations. As you scan, you can see the 3D model forming on the screen. This helps you ensure that you’re capturing everything you need.
6. Versatile Applications
The Freestyle 3D X is used in various fields, including architecture, engineering, art, and even virtual reality. Its versatility makes it a valuable tool for many different projects.

Applications of the FARO Freestyle 3D X
The FARO Freestyle 3D X is used in a variety of industries. Here are some examples of how it is applied:
1. Architecture and Construction
In architecture, the scanner is used to create detailed 3D models of buildings and spaces. Architects can use these models to design new structures or renovate existing ones. The accuracy of the scans ensures that everything fits together perfectly.
2. Heritage Preservation
The Freestyle 3D X is excellent for capturing historical sites and artifacts. By creating 3D models of these important locations, it helps preserve their details for future generations. This is crucial for restoration efforts and educational purposes.
3. Art and Design
Artists and designers can use the scanner to create 3D representations of their work. This allows them to analyze their designs and share them with others in a more engaging way. Imagine being able to showcase your sculpture in 3D online!
4. Forensics
In forensic science, the FARO Freestyle 3D X is used to create accurate 3D representations of crime scenes. This helps investigators analyze the scene and present evidence in court. The detailed scans can provide crucial insights into what happened.
5. Virtual Reality and Gaming
The scanner can also be used in the virtual reality and gaming industries. By creating realistic 3D models of environments, developers can create immersive experiences for players. This adds a layer of realism that enhances gameplay.
